Fall in Moab is a gorgeous time of year. The daytime temperatures are typically 70 to 80 degrees, and the nighttime temperatures drop to the 40s and 50s. The daytime is just about perfect weather for hiking, mountain biking, jeeping, and exploring the national parks.  The night is perfect weather for sitting in the hot tub, relaxing by the fire, or enjoying the evening out of the deck gazing at the stars. The weather is perfect for a Moab fall vacation.

The fall colors around Moab and the La Sal Mountains are amazing. The red rock formations with fall colors and sunsets make for amazing color combinations and opportunities to get unique and spectacular pictures of some of the iconic arches and canyons in the Moab area. The La Sal Mountains just south of the Moab are full of trails and dirt roads to explore during the fall.  The fall colors in the La Sal Mountains are amazing and is one of the best areas in Utah to enjoy a fall vacation. It is a great spot to take a ride with your family in your jeep or ATV.

In addition to the amazing fall weather and the beautiful fall colors the crowds are much smaller in the fall. During the summer vacation months Moab can be quite crowded and lines to get into Arches and Canyonlands can be long. In the fall months lines are much shorter and hikes in these gorgeous national parks are much less crowded. Downtown Moab is also much quieter and laid back. This is a great time of year for a Moab fall vacation if you enjoy a quieter atmosphere.
